Title:
MANUFACTURE OF HEAT EXCHANGE ELEMENT
Document Type and Number:
Japanese Patent JPS5843398
Kind Code:
A
Abstract:

PURPOSE: To easily obtain the heat accumulating type heat exchange element with excellent heat resisting property by a method wherein an element with predetermined shape is formed of ceramic fiber paper and heated under oxygen starvation atmosphere in order to remove its organic components by gasification and then impregnated with inorganic reinforcing agent.

CONSTITUTION: A corrugated formed body 9 is formed by passing papers 1 and 2 mainly made of ceramic fiber through forming rollers 4, a pressing roller 6 and a bonding agent coating roller 7b and, after that, taken-up through a coating roller 8b to a core 11 in order to get a formed body 3. Said formed body 3 is heated in the air, in which the oxygen is, for example, 1/3W1/5 times that in the normal air, at a temperature of 400W500°C in order to remove organic substance by gasification. Next, the formed body 3 is immersed in inorganic reinforcing agent such as silica sol or the like in order to be impregnated therewith and then dried. In such a manner as mentioned above, the heat exchange element capable of resisting high temperature is easily obtained out of ceramic fiber paper.
